What Can The Margaritaville Explorer Blender Do?
This Margaritaville Explorer Blender (DM0900) is a battery powered device that can be taken anywhere the owner sees fit.
While most blenders are not well equipped to chop ice and have difficulty making frozen drinks, this margarita maker is specially designed with a variety of pre-programmed blending settings to make perfectly smooth and enjoyable frozen beverages. In fact, on one set of batteries, this blender can make up to sixty drinks, mixing thirty-six ounces at a time.
Along with the ability to keep the drinks coming, this portable blender does not require inconvenient and messy cords, just a few batteries to keep the party going.

How to Make a Margarita – The Perfect Margarita
Posted on | June 12, 2010 | No Comments
How to Make a Margarita – The Perfect Margarita
How to make a margarita, an easy question and an even easier one to answer and master. There are predominantly two major ways to make them – a frozen margarita or a margarita on the rocks. We will talk about both, but the tougher question is what to put in your margarita. Some minimalists would argue that a margarita should only include 100% agave tequila while others, myself included agree that a classic margarita recipe should include 100% agave tequila, Cointreau and Grand Marnier for instance. I have included several recipes for you to try.
How To Make a Margarita – the Frozen Margarita
In order to make a frozen margarita you will need the following items:
A margarita machine, daiquiri machine, frozen drink machine or just a plain old blender A premium 100% agave tequila of your choice Cointreau or other orange liqueur and Grand Marnier if you wish – try it both ways A frozen margarita mix or fresh limes Ice
Typically all ingredients would be added at the same time in the margarita machine and blended evenly until smooth. Some margarita machines and other frozen drink machines make the process easier but taking the ice and shaving it for a better margarita drink. If using fresh ingredients like lemons and or limes instead of a margarita mix, be sure to juice the limes fully and toss the remains.
Here are a few frozen margarita recipes.
2 ounces of premium 100% blue agave tequila
1/2 ounces of fresh lime juice or Rose’s sweetened lime juice
3/4 ounce Cointreau
Splash sweet-and-sour mix or margarita mix
2 ounces of premium 100% blue agave tequila
2 ounces of fresh lime juice
1/2 ounce Cointreau
1/2 ounce Grand Marnier
Ice
Blend as described above and serve in salted or unsalted margarita glasses. Its very straightforward but dont be afraid to mix up the ingredients and try some different margarita recipes and include some like a strawberry margarita or a mango margarita.
How To Make a Margarita – Margarita On The Rocks
In order to make a margarita on the rocks, you will need the following items:
A shaker A premium 100% agave tequila of your choice Cointreau or other orange liqueur and Grand Marnier if you wish – try it both ways A non frozen margarita mix or fresh limes Ice
Typically all ingredients would be added at the same time in the shaker along with a handful of ice, shaken – but not too hard – and then served in a salted or unsalted margarita glass. If using fresh ingredients like lemons and or limes instead of a margarita mix, be sure to juice the limes fully and toss the remains.

Margaritaville DM0500 Bahamas 36-Ounce Frozen-Concoction Maker
- 450-watt frozen-concoction maker blends up to 36 ounces
- Dual motors for shaving ice and blending beverages; ice reservoir
- Manual shave/blend option for customized drinks; dishwasher-safe parts
- Shot glass, recipes, and instructions
- Measures approximately 14-2/5 by 8-2/7 by 18 inches
The New Margaritaville Frozen Concoction Maker – Bahamas is your passport to transport your next party to the islands. Simply fill the top reservoir with ice, pour your favorite ingredients into the jar and at the touch of a button, the Shave-N-Blend controls automatically make a pitcher-perfect 36 ounces of frozen margarita deliciousness in one easy step. The shaved ice ensures better drink consistency – no more ice chunks or watered down drinks. The Bahamas allows you to shave only and blend
